Mega R.A.C. entry for Tour of Hamsterley

With three weeks to go, the West Wales Rally Spares R.A.C Rally Championship entry for the SG Petch Tour of Hamsterley (Sunday 28 April) is already packed with quality and quantity.Over 50 R.A.C. contenders are expected to pack out a capacity 90-car entry for the event and the entry list already reads like a whos who of historic rallying. At the head of the field will be current R.A.C. championship leader Nick Elliott, but he faces a tremendous challenge from Steve Bannister, who can claim greater knowledge of the Hamsterley complex than his Rallysport Developments team mate.With an entry due from Marty McCormack, the stage is set for a fabulous contest, which could replay the contests of both the 2012 Roger Albert Clark Rally (McCormack v Bannister) and the 2013 Mid Wales Stages (Elliott v McCormack).However, this is far from being just a three-way battle. More very quick Ford Escort Mk2s will be campaigned by Jason Pritchard, Will Onions, Matt Edwards, Tim Pearcey, Paul Griffiths, Warren Philliskirk, Rob Smith, Matthew Robinson, Jonathan Brace, Richard Lane, Peter Slights, Jason Lepley, Will Nicholls, James Potter, Alan Walker and more. It will be the finest historic field ever seen outside Wales and will deliver a fabulous spectacle for the fans from the north-east.Packing out the other categories will be front-runners like Chris Browne (Escort Mk1), Terry Cree (BMW 2002), Dick Slaughter (Escort Mk1), Steve Magson (Vauxhall Chevette), Peter Smith (Opel Kadett), Iwan Rees (Ford Escort Mk1) and Mark Spencer (Ford Escort Mk2), while father and son John and Will Midgely will go head-to-head in a pair of Toyota Corollas. Importantly, the event has already attracted an encouraging entry of Category 1 cars. The Lotus Cortinas of Simon Wallis and Pete Gunson will go up against the Alfa Romeo of John Everard, the Mini Cooper of Colin Forster and the Singer Chamois of Chris Tooze.The Tour of Hamsterley is a round of four regional championships, including the Motoscope Northern Historic Rally Championship. An agreement is in place to allow crews in historic cars to score points on both the R.A.C. and Northern championships.The Tour of Hamsterley is organised by Stockton & District Motor Club in association with Teesside Motor Sport Group.
